    We did it both ways. Last September/October we took our first long trip from Austin Texas to Utah. I used the RV Trip Wizard to help plan the trip out to Utah. I knew we wanted to travel 5-6 hours per day, so we planned stopes in Lubbock, Albuquerque and then to Moab. From Moab we went to Herber City, then to Tropic. One the way back we left Tropic planning to stay in Flagstaff, but we made such good time that we ended up staying in Holbrook AZ and then came on back to Austin (we had a death in the family, so our return trip plans changed).

    If this is your first big trip, I would definitely would use a tool like Trip Wizard to plan the trip. As a member of our forum you are already a member of Trip Wizard. Using Trip Wizard you set up a driving radius and it will show you the campgrounds, restaurants, and fuel stations. In our case we knew how far we wanted to travel a day and about where we wanted to stop so it gave us a driving time and miles. That way we knew we could leave by 10am and have plenty of time to get to our destination. We also found that we could call a campground and cancel with no penalty since we were traveling through. The only thing it didn't show us was road construction and between Gallup NM and Moab there was a bunch. The mileage was correct but the travel time was way off.

    One nice thing about Trip Wizard it shows you the campgrounds by either KOA, Good Sam's or local ownership. Then you can go to campground reviews to review the campground before you book.

    Thank you for posing this question! We are getting ready to head out on our first epic trip - 3 months - leaving August 13. We're not retired, so will be working on the road and internet connectivity is a big one for us. (Tricked out our 22 MLE for just this!) We have the same dilemma, we want to plan far enough out so we know where we'll be and don't have to worry about the hassle, but yet want some flexibility. We're not sure our 'style' quite yet - and that factored into what we've done. Here's the compromise we ended up following:
    - We've planned out 4 weeks, with every stop. That will take us through the busiest season when the campgrounds are full.
    - We're planning on 'planning out' every week one additional week - so we're always 4 weeks out.
    -We're building into our schedule some days where we don't have a reservation. That gives us some flexibility to stay or go in areas of high interest.
    -I'm the planner and have used some really great apps out there - Campendium, RoadTrippers and AllStays. I think these are essential.
    -I haven't invested in a Harvest Host membership, but am quite interested. We need to understand our comfort level with 'boon docking' some nights when we're going from one place to another. I'm nervous about it, but again, want to try it out a few times and see what my comfort level is with it. Harvest Hosts is apparently a great option if Walmart/Cabela's boondocking sometimes is not your cup of tea.
    - We planned out the first 4 weeks to give us a 'bang' of a start. I also thought we'd have loads of energy in the beginning, so wasn't too worried about moving too often in the beginning.
